commit fff774eda3ed04d319232b108a94282af24cc6b0
Author: David Holder <david.holder at erion.co.uk>
Date: Wed May 13 15:10:47 2015 +0100
s3: IPv6 enabled DNS connections for ADS client
This patch makes DNS client connections protocol independent.
For example DNS updates. This makes IPv6-only clients possible.
Signed-off-by: David Holder <david.holder at erion.co.uk>
Reviewed-by: Jeremy Allison <jra at samba.org>
Reviewed-by: Ralph Böhme <rb at sernet.de>
